Privilege motion moved against Chautala

In Haryana assembly, ruling party today moved privilege motion against leader of opposition Om Parkash Chautala (INLD) for 'misleading the House by making a false statement during a speech in the discussion on budget yesterday Speaker Harmohinder Singh Chatha admitted the privilege motion moved by Congress MLA Kuldeep Sharma who contended that Mr Chautala had made a false statement on the floor of the house by claiming that the government had imposed VAT on salt during his speech on the budget yesterday.<br/><br/>Mr Sharma said that Mr Chautala had made the statement 'wilfully and deliberately which is contempt of House and breach of privilege. When motion moved, the INLD members staged a walk out from the House. <br/><br/>The motion was admitted by a voice vote and the speaker decided to refer the matter to a privileges committee. The committee had been asked to give a report by the first week of next session.
